Open Data MCP is an open - source project aiming to quickly connect public data sets to LLM applications through the MCP protocol, enabling convenient access to open data and community - based publishing.

What is the Model Context Protocol (MCP) Server?

The MCP server is a tool that allows you to integrate public open data sets into your language model applications through simple settings. This means you can directly ask the model questions about this data without manually processing the data.

How to use the MCP server?

Using the MCP server is very simple. You can complete the setup in just a few steps. First, install the necessary software; then, run our CLI tool to connect to the data source; finally, start using this data in your application.

Applicable Scenarios

The MCP server is very suitable for application scenarios that require quick access to a large amount of publicly available information, such as traffic management and educational resource queries.
